Kuwait City (KWI) to Silgadi Doti (SIH)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Kuwait International Airport (KWI) in Kuwait City, Kuwait to Silgadi Doti Airport (SIH) in Silgadi Doti, Nepal is 3,187 kilometers (1,980 miles / 1,721 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ying east at a heading of 82°.
